Watch as I tuck her under-chin with a large non-surgical suture! If we were to compare your body to a vehicle that houses your consciousness, this would be akin to fixing a fallen front bumper.
However, this is a temporary solution. It requires maintenance every 2 years for those under 40, and annually for individuals over 60. Many opt for this ongoing solution to "fallen bumper" situations to avoid surgical interventions. Remember, preventing a falling bumper is key! If you missed the decade to address the under-chin sag, surgical repair might be necessary, especially if it significantly affects your sleep due to conditions like sleep apnea.
It's worth noting that many aren't candidates for the surgical fix as it's deemed cosmetic, making it an out-of-pocket expense. Even post-surgery, annual skin tightening treatments are recommended. Ultherapy—a non-surgical ultrasound skin tailoring device—is an excellent choice. It functions like a sewing machine, and PDO threading can be done a month or two before or after the Ultherapy treatment.
